css动画完成后效果保持不变,css动画完成后效果保持不变怎么回事-Html/Css
接下来我们来看一个动画效果(类似于通常的页面滚动功能),一个球沿着一定的路径移动。最简单的方法是实时调整它们的left和top属性,并使用css动画。
}最好使用语义名称。一个好的CSS类名应该描述它是什么而不是它看起来像什么。避免!重要的是,其实你也应该会用其他高质量的选择器。尽可能简化规则,可以进一步合并不同类别的重复规则。好了,我总结一下这9点。
降低重排的方式:要么减少次数,要么降低影响范围,创建新的复合图层就是第二种优化方式。
网页压缩技术就网页压缩而言,相信各位站长都很熟悉。主要是启用服务器Gzip,压缩页面Gzip,减少元素的‘体积’,从而减少数据传输,提高网页加载速度。
动画速度曲线:animation-timing-function:变化类型;变化类型有:linear匀速;ease-in开始慢;ease-out结束慢;ease动画有一个缓慢的开始,然后快,结束慢。
在CSS3出现之前,动画都是通过jAVAScript动态的改变元素的样式属性来完成了,这种方式虽然能够实现动画,但是在性能上存在一些问题。CSS3的出现,让动画变得更加容易,性能也更加好。
可以直接用css3写,或者用js定时器控制,看你具体要实现什么动画。
循环动画由几幅画面构成,要根据动作的循环规律确定。但是,只有三张以上的画面才能产生循环变化效果,两幅画面只能起到晃动的效果。在循环动画中有一种特殊情况,就是反向循环。
你用CSS3的方式提前写好动画样式,不要调用这个类。将鼠标设置在前端,添加一个类,这样鼠标一点,就会有CSS3动画,鼠标离开去掉样式,动画就结束了。
1、#1ec7e6;width:90px;height:60px;font-size:16px;}HTML鼠标移动到我这里全程css3,无需javascript。(需要支持css3的浏览器才能看到效果。)希望能帮助到你。
2、设置在3秒内完成颜色的变化可以分别对不同的属性分开做时间长度的设定,记得用逗号隔开延迟delay:想在某个属性开始执行样式变化后的多少秒,才让另一个属性开始进行样式的动态变化,就可以使用延迟。
3、首先,准备好HTML前期工作以及对DIV的一个简单设置。然后,新建keyframes元素,命名为myFirst。然后,可以在设置百分比,不仅仅只能设置4个,大家可以根据需求设置。这时候,可以为他写上各种百分比的颜色。
4、button{width:100px;height:50px;border:0;color:white;background:-webkit-radial-gradient(#72787f,#545c64);}浏览器运行index.html页面,此时用CSS实现了按钮中间白、四周黑,上方白、下方灰的效果。
要是想长时间的停止。用JS插入这个属性就好了。
所以当需要触发伪类的效果时,动画还是会依然进行,这时候就需要停止之前的无限循环的动画了。用css3的思路就是重新设置一个伪类的动画,把前面的动画给覆盖了。
none:不改变默认行为。forwards:当动画完成后,保持最后一个属性值(在最后一个关键帧中定义)。backwards:在animation-delay所指定的一段时间内,在动画显示之前,应用开始属性值(在第一个关键帧中定义)。
将动画绑定到选择器:在样式中,设置动画属性animation,自定义动画名称和时长。规定动画开始时的等待时间:animation-delay:时间;可以为秒、毫秒2s,2ms。
如何从Linux命令行截屏1、方法2:使用GIMP程序安装GIMP程序。点击“...
如何使用jQuery批量移除class在jquery中,用所有匹配的元素实现从...
anaconda如何计算全部代码行数wc命令主要功能是统计指定文件中的字节数、...
window安装了mysql5.7.13后,怎么卸载mysql命令cmdst...
IP云是一个程序开发,程序设计,ip代理,程序员学习技术站,专注分享知识、经验、观念。在这里,所有程序员都能找到答案、参与讨论。